On the other side, at the live show, the cameras were rolling, capturing the preparation of the two competing teams.
Miranda, trying to avoid upsetting Marion, decided to keep quiet for the time being. After all, she didn't want her newly launched company to crumble because of a PR disaster.
However, her silence seemed to dampen the show's buzz. Sebastian, too, wasn't saying much. He just sat there with an air of elegance, occasionally sipping his coffee, and every now and then, he'd glance at Miranda, whispering a few words to her. This only added to the silence in the guest seat.
There was sporadic commentary from another director guest, but for the most part, the only sounds in the studio came from the two teams.
The host decided to stir things up and handed the mic over to Miranda. What followed was a scene like this during the teams' prep time.
When Arabella started whining, trying to avoid training, Miranda chimed in, "What's my take? I'd say the team should just replace her."
As Arabella lagged behind in practice, whining, "Oh, I'm so bad at this, I'm such a klutz, I give up, I can't do it," Miranda didn't hold back. "Yuck, does she really think that's cute?"
When Lysander comforted Arabella, saying, "It's alright, Bella, just stick with me, it's no big deal if you can't keep up," Miranda quipped, "Wow, that's impressive. If they lose, maybe they should just leave the circle."
Seeing the stars of the Shadow Reapers were diligently practicing with their teammates, Miranda noted, "Vivian's got great speed and sharp reflexes. Well, she's quite the looker. Their teamwork's solid, way better than dealing with that dead weight of the other team."

When the Shadow Reapers analyzed their new members, Miranda observed, "No complaints here, their analysis is spot on. The new members all adopt aggressive strategy, switching to that suits their lineup perfectly."
"Oof, better not say anything. Arabella's fans might come at me with 'if you're so good, why don't you do it?' Well, I have a busy schedule."
"Arabella herself said she isn't good, so what are you expecting from her? If you're so good, why don't you do it?"
"Some folks should just chill. Even if Bella's not great, so what? Don't forget there’s Lysander. Our guy will carry Bella to victory, no sweat!"
